Dean Heil to Wrestle Austin O’Connor on December 4th
Heil and O’Connor to wrestle at Tar Heel Wrestling Open
Coleman Scott and the Tar Heel Wrestling Club will be hosting an event on December 4th called the Tar Heel Wrestling Open. The event will be aired on Fite TV and will feature former Cowboy and two-time NCAA champion Dean Heil.
Heil will be taking on Austin O’Connor, who finished third at the 2019 NCAA championships at 149 pounds.
The Tar Heel Wrestling Club has announced eight other bouts for the event, one featuring the son of Oklahoma State legend Kenny Monday.
North Carolina is coached by former Cowboy Coleman Scott, who is assisted by other former Cowboys Jamill Kelly and Gary Wayne Harding.
The Tar Heel Wrestling Club is led by former Cowboy Kenny Monday and features another former Cowboy Jordan Oliver as one of their premier athletes.
Heil currently trains with the Navy-Marine Corps RTC in Annapolis, Maryland.
